Abstract

In matters of design quality assurance, special attention is paid to the reliable operation of products under various operating conditions, ensuring the operability of the material property relationships. The article examines approaches to studying the patterns of processes and phenomena and formalized procedures for making changes to their mathematical description. The necessity of testing physical concepts and representations that are geometric, statistical, and then thermodynamic analogies (integral or averaged) is shown. The problems of generalization are considered using the example of critical phenomena of different nature.
